AT 2203

Introduction to Programmable Controllers

Catalog description

This course examines how microprocessors and programmable logic controllers (PLCs) integrate with sensors, actuators, and industrial communication methods to operate as coordinated automation systems. Students learn to do basic setup, configuration, and programming of microprocessors, then apply structured troubleshooting techniques to diagnose both hardware and software issues. Through hands-on activities, learners build practical skills in system integration, control logic, and basic industrial networking concepts. Emphasis is placed on developing job-ready competencies that transfer to a wide range of automated industrial workplaces.
